1. 2nd annual Perdido Beach Resort Half Marathon, 5K & Fun Run
![5 spring events for the ultimate festival season in Orange Beach 2 Perdido Beach Resort](https://i0.wp.com/bhamnow.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/3-Perdido-Beach-Resort-Half-Marathon-Perdido-Beach-Resort.jpg?resize=1200%2C733&quality=89&ssl=1)
The Greater Birmingham Area is known as a great place for runners—whether at a designated walking trail or during a unique fundraising 5K.
This spring, you can get your sprint on beachside during the 2nd Annual Perdido Beach Resort Half Mile, 5K & Fun Run.
This is Perdido Beach Resort’s second year hosting the event and they have some fun things planned, whether you choose to run, walk or cheer on those who do.
Fast facts about the race:
- It benefits the Jennifer Claire Moore Foundation (JCMF), a nonprofit dedicated to supporting the mental health and emotional well-being of youth across Baldwin County.
- Last year, 349 runners participated + $11,000 was raised for JCMF.
Event details:
- When: Saturday, March 8 | 5:45-11AM
- Where: Perdido Beach Resort, 27200 Perdido Beach Blvd, Orange Beach, AL 36561

2. Orange Beach Festival of Art
If you’re a fan of local events like Magic City Art Connection and Moss Rock Festival, you’ll have a blast at the Orange Beach Festival of Art taking place in early March.
Here’s why you’ll love the event:
- It’s family-friendly with food + activities for all ages.
- You’ll discover new artists + unique creations.
- It includes live music + entertainment on 2 stages.
Event details:
- When:
- Saturday, March 8 | 10AM-5PM
- Sunday, March 9 | 10AM-4PM
- Where: Orange Beach Art Center, 26389 Canal Rd, Orange Beach, AL 36561
- Cost: Free admission
3. The Wharf Boat and Yacht Show
![5 spring events for the ultimate festival season in Orange Beach 4 Perdido Beach Resort](https://i0.wp.com/bhamnow.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/6-Perdido-Beach-Resort.jpg?resize=1200%2C800&quality=89&ssl=1)
Are you one of the many across Birmingham who can’t wait to set sail on the lake or beach the moment warm weather hits? You better hurry to Orange Beach to The Wharf Boat and Yacht Show this March.
This annual event is a marine enthusiast’s Disney World, featuring:
- 120+ exhibitors
- Instructional seminars
- Live music
- + more!
Event details:
- When:
- Friday, March 21 + Saturday, March 22 | 10AM-6PM
- Sunday, March 23 | 10AM-4PM
- Where: The Wharf, 23101 Canal Rd, Orange Beach, AL 36561
- Cost: Daily Pass $15 | 3-Day Pass $25
4. Inaugural Gulf Shores L.O.L. Festival
![5 spring events for the ultimate festival season in Orange Beach 5 Perdido Beach Resort](https://i0.wp.com/bhamnow.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/3-Perdido-Beach-Resort.jpg?resize=1200%2C645&quality=89&ssl=1)
Any festival that has “LOL” in it has my attention—especially one that is brand new.
The L.O.L. Festival is a fun way to boost your spring and party with Gulf Coast locals.
It’s a three-day event at Gulf State Park in Gulf Shores filled with food, live music, artistry, and family entertainment.
You can even enhance your festival experience with VIP tickets that grant you front-row seats to musical performances throughout the weekend.
Event details:
- When:
- Friday, March 28 + Saturday, March 29 | 10AM10PM
- Sunday, March 30 | 10AM-5PM
- Where: Gulf State Park, 20115 State Park Rd, Gulf Shores, AL 36542
- Cost:
- Single Day $30 | Single Day VIP $65
- 3-Day $75 | 3-Day VIP $175
- Kids ages 5 and under—free admission
